Output 8ec521068f3e01c9f12fab642d0b7f316bbc0fd3d4433321063833dca00ae4b7:21

value
541641
script pubkey
OP_0 OP_PUSHBYTES_20 bff3ed658aff35ba3565d2a6c5f756d3272a0b0a
address
bc1qhle76ev2lu6m5dt962nvta6k6vnj5zc2aqu4yv
transaction
8ec521068f3e01c9f12fab642d0b7f316bbc0fd3d4433321063833dca00ae4b7
spent
true